ACCET Log Coordinator

Are you organized, detail-oriented, and excited to work in a fast-paced broadcast environment?

The Agile Creative Content Engagement Team (ACCET) is looking for motivated team players to join our growing centralized operations team as Log Coordinators. In this role, you'll support daily log production across multiple markets while working closely with Senior Log Coordinators and leadership to help ensure accuracy, consistency, and on-time delivery.

This is a great opportunity for someone who enjoys organization, communication, and working behind the scenes to help keep broadcast operations running smoothly.

What You Will Do

  • Support daily log production and execution across multiple stations and markets.
  • Assist with maintaining accurate promotion inventory, copy, and scheduling information.
  • Communicate with stations and internal teams regarding daily log needs and updates.
  • Help ensure logs are accurate, complete, and delivered on schedule.
  • Support traffic, reporting, and operational workflows as assigned.
  • Maintain organization of promotional assets and operational materials.
  • Assist Senior Log Coordinators with day-to-day operational tasks and coverage needs.
  • Learn and navigate broadcast traffic systems and workflow processes.
  • Support additional operational and administrative tasks as needed.

About Us

Sinclair, Inc. (Nasdaq: SBGI) is a diversified media company and a leading provider of local news and sports. The Company owns, operates and/or provides services to 177 television stations in 79 markets affiliated with all major broadcast networks; owns Tennis Channel, the premium destination for tennis enthusiasts; and multicast networks CHARGE, Comet, ROAR and The Nest. Sinclair's AMP Media produces a growing portfolio of digital content and original podcasts. Additional information about Sinclair can be found at www.sbgi.net .

The hourly compensation range for this role is $16.50 to $18.18. Final compensation for this role will be determined by various factors such as a candidate's relevant work experience, skills, certifications, and geographic location. Full time positions are eligible for benefits that include participation in a retirement plan, life and disability insurance, health, dental and vision plans, flexible spending accounts, 15 paid vacation days, 2 paid personal days, 9 paid holidays, 40 hours of paid sick leave, parental leave, and employee stock purchase plan.
